Transaction

0f89889c36990bd96109a59567cb0db6a511e2cfe68f030d3daf5febc00d4b51
414,599 confirmations
Timestamp
1526699847
Block523,328
Fee22,537 sats
Fee rate31 sats/vB
view on mempool.space

Inputs & Outputs